Caoimhe is a girl's name of Irish origin meaning "gentle," "beautiful" or "precious," from the Irish caomh. Pronounced KEE-va, it ranked 31st in Ireland in 2025 and is one of the most consistently used Irish-language girls' names.
- Caoimhe is a name of Irish origin.
- Peaked in Ireland in 2011, when 398 babies were given the name.
- It has been falling over the past decade in Ireland.
- Today about 1 in 345 babies in Ireland is given this name.
- First appears in birth records in 1966.

What Caoimhe means
Caoimhe means gentle, beautiful and precious all at once — the Irish caomh covers kindness and dearness as readily as physical beauty, so the name describes character before appearance.
Where Caoimhe comes from
Caoimhe is formed from the Irish caomh, meaning gentle, dear or beautiful, and is the feminine counterpart of Caoimhín, which English speakers know as Kevin. Where Kevin traveled worldwide in its anglicized form, Caoimhe never acquired a comparable English spelling and so stayed within Ireland and the Irish diaspora. The spelling is the single biggest obstacle to its wider use: aoi represents one long vowel and mh sounds as a v, giving KEE-va, which almost no English reader arrives at unaided.
Caoimhe in use
Caoimhe ranked 31st in Ireland in 2025 with 130 births and 71st in Northern Ireland. Beyond the island it thins out sharply — 1,118 in England and Wales and 5,302 in the United States — which makes it a good measure of how far spelling alone limits a name's reach, since its male counterpart Kevin has been a worldwide staple.

Where Caoimhe is used
Irish figures withhold any name given to fewer than three babies in a year, so a gap means the name fell below that floor rather than went unused. The Central Statistics Office began recording the síneadh fada in 2018, so accented and unaccented spellings are counted separately from that year on. Data & sources.
